     282/**
     283 * Get most recent video mode hints.
     284 * @param  pCtx      the context containing the heap to use
     285 * @param  cScreens  the number of screens to query hints for, starting at 0.
     286 * @param  pHints    array of VBVAMODEHINT structures for receiving the hints.
     287 * @returns  iprt status code
     288 * @returns  VERR_NO_MEMORY      HGSMI heap allocation failed.
     289 * @returns  VERR_NOT_SUPPORTED  Host does not support this command.
     290 */
     291RTDECL(int) VBoxHGSMIGetModeHints(PHGSMIGUESTCOMMANDCONTEXT pCtx,
     292                                  unsigned cScreens, VBVAMODEHINT *paHints)
     293{
     294    int rc;
     295    AssertPtrReturn(paHints, VERR_INVALID_POINTER);
     296    void *p = VBoxHGSMIBufferAlloc(pCtx,   sizeof(VBVAQUERYMODEHINTS)
     297                                         + cScreens * sizeof(VBVAMODEHINT),
     298                                   HGSMI_CH_VBVA, VBVA_QUERY_MODE_HINTS);
     299    if (!p)
     300    {
     301        LogFunc(("HGSMIHeapAlloc failed\n"));
     302        return VERR_NO_MEMORY;
     303    }
     304    else
     305    {
     306        VBVAQUERYMODEHINTS *pQuery   = (VBVAQUERYMODEHINTS *)p;
     307
     308        pQuery->cHintsQueried        = cScreens;
     309        pQuery->cbHintStructureGuest = sizeof(VBVAMODEHINT);
     310        pQuery->rc                   = VERR_NOT_SUPPORTED;
     311
     312        VBoxHGSMIBufferSubmit(pCtx, p);
     313        rc = pQuery->rc;
     314        if (RT_SUCCESS(rc))
     315            memcpy(paHints, ((uint8_t *)p) + sizeof(VBVAQUERYMODEHINTS),
     316                   cScreens * sizeof(VBVAMODEHINT));
     317
     318        VBoxHGSMIBufferFree(pCtx, p);
     319    }
     320    return rc;
     321}
